CAG compiled a nice list of all the Black Friday ads that have begun leaking out. Didn't see a thread yet.

Tons of stuff, but I just pulled the more interesting hardware bundles.
That CC $199 Xbox 360 deal below is awesome (my launch 360 won't die).

Best Buy
Xbox 360 Pro 60GB Holiday Bundle with Tony Hawk Proving Ground & NBA 2k9 $299.99
Playstation 3 80GB w/ Ratchet & Clank & Casino Royale Blu-ray $399.99 (door buster)

Circuit City
Xbox 360 60 GB Pro Holiday Bundle + $30 Gift Card $299.99
Xbox 360 Arcade Holiday Bundle + 20GB HD & Wireless Controller $199.99

Dell
Xbox 360 Arcade Holiday Bundle w/Rock Band 2 Game - $199.00

Radio Shack
Xbox 360 Pro 60GB Hoilday Bundle + $50 pre-paid card via mail in rebate $299.99

Target
Xbox 360 60GB Pro Holiday Bundle with $60 Gift Card $299.99

Walmart
Xbox 360 Arcade Holiday Bundle w/free Guitar Hero III + Wireless Guitar $199
